"Arrows" in widgets are those GUI elements mostly represented by
triangles pointing in a particular direction as in scrollbars,
choice widgets, some menus, valuators and Fl_Counter widgets.
The code has been simplified and standardized such that all these
GUI elements are drawn identically per FLTK scheme.
Widget authors no longer need to write code to calculate arrow sizes
and draw polygons etc.
Different schemes can and do implement different drawing functions.

Under non-macOS platforms, the key is to call glUseProgram(0); after having used OpenGL 3
which allows to then use OpenGL 1 and draw FLTK widgets over the OpenGL3 scene.
Under macOS, this is impossible because macOS GL3 contexts are not compatible
with GL1. The solution implemented here is to create an additional Fl_Gl_Window
placed above and sized as the GL3-based window, to give it a non opaque,
GL1-based context, and to put the FLTK widgets in that additional window.

Conflicting demands arise in the implementation of class Fl_Xlib_Graphics_Driver
for drawing images with the XRender library :
1) Issue #163 leads to use a bilinear filter to draw-and-scale images.
2) This tends to blur the edges of drawn areas which is bad for tiled images
(that is because the edges get alpha values, even for an opaque source image).
This commit resolves the conflict adding a means to detect whether the library
is busy drawing a tiled image. If so, the bilinear filter is not applied, drawn areas
don't have blurred edges, resulting in a nice tiling.
With this commit, these test apps perform correctly:
- tiled_image is correct at all scaling factor values also when modified
to use a depth-3 or a depth-4 Fl_RGB_Image as tile;
- unittests - Drawing Images is correct at all scaling factor values;
- pixmap_browser scales correctly up and down JPEG and PNG images.
